Holy trinity food. Gumbo ( Louisiana Creole: Gum-bo) is a stew that is popular in the U.S. state of Louisiana, and is the official state cuisine. [1] Gumbo consists primarily of a strongly flavored stock, meat or shellfish (or sometimes both), a thickener, and the Creole "holy trinity" – celery, bell peppers, and onions. Jul 5, 2016 · The Holy Trinity is a classic flavor base when cooking Cajun dishes. It is typically arrived at by sauteing a combination of diced onions, bell peppers and celery. Cooking the vegetables in butter or oil releases their flavor, which is infused into any sauce mixture when other ingredients are added. The Holy Trinity is the basis of most Cajun ... Barry Lillie. | Sat, 03/15/2014 - 03:45. Soffritto is the essential base to Italian soups, stews and some sauces that chefs often refer to as "the holy trinity". The basis of soffritto is simply a combination of three key ingredients: celery, onion and carrot. What 3 ingredients make up the Trinity in Cajun and Creole cooking? The Cajun holy trinity recipe calls for one part white onion, one part green bell pepper, and one part celery. Some recipes and preparations also include green onion or shallots, parsley, and garlic which is sometimes referred to as adding the pope.

As a culinary term, the holy trinity originally refers specifically to chopped onions, bell peppers, and celery, combined in a rough ratio of 1:1:1 and used as the staple base for much of the cooking in the Cajun and Louisiana Creole cuisine. The preparation of classic Cajun/Creole dishes such as étouffée, gumbo, and ...
